Kelsey Creek Park offers a unique blend of a working farm with diverse animals for up-close viewing and learning, expansive nature trails (including stairway hikes), and a playground, all nestled within a serene and well-maintained park. It serves as an idyllic and educational escape for families, providing a peaceful retreat from suburban life.

🛡️Safety Policy

  • Inclement Weather Plan: The City of Bellevue Parks & Community Services Department will make every effort to clearly communicate the status of facilities and programs, scheduled special events, and rentals. Operational decisions are based upon the safety of participants and employees and the ability to appropriately staff programs and facilities. Some facilities may open on a modified schedule for drop-in activities. Visitors should call the facility for an updated status report. If unable to reach the facility, call the Parks & Community Services Department general information number at 425-452-6885. Inclement weather can affect park use and trail conditions; visitors should use caution as trails and other park facilities may become wet and slippery. Park trails may also be closed.
  • Pet Policy: All dogs and other pets must be on leash at all times when visiting Kelsey Creek Community Park. Pets are strictly prohibited from the barnyard out of respect for the farm animals' health and well-being. Service animals are always welcome while providing assistance to their human partner.
